The Rewa soccer team is living up to their promise in the INKK Mobile Battle of the Giants as the team to beat after thumping Tavua 5-2 in their second pool game.
Last Sunday it was the delta tigers that upset defending champion Ba 2-1 and again this afternoon they proved too strong for Tavua.
Rewa now leads Pool 1 with 6 points from 2 games, Labasa is in second place with 4 points after 2 games, Navua has 2 points while defending champions Ba has 1 point.
In Pool 2 the Nadroga soccer team kept their chances alive with a 3-nil win against Nasinu in their 3rd pool game. The Stallions after holding the highly fancied Lautoka team to a nil all draw last night proved too strong for Nasinu.
Striker Samuela Drudru now is the leading goal scorer in the BOG with 3 goals.
Nadroga now leads Pool 2 with 5 points from 3 games, followed by Lautoka on 4 points from 2 games, Nadi has 3 points from one game.
Results from last night, Nadroga held Lautoka to a nil all draw, Nadi beat Suva 1-nil, Navua and Ba played to a 2 all draw and Labasa defeated Tavua 2-1.
The next match will be at 5pm, Nadi takes on Nasinu, Navua plays Tavua at 6:15, at 7:30 Lautoka take on Suva and in the last match today, defending champions Ba take on Labasa at 8:45pm.
